If there are four movie icons, numbered 1 to 4, and I delete 2, then create a new movie icon which begins as number 5, is there any way I can reassign #5 so that it's not just called "2", but actually is regarded by DVD-Lab as the second movie.
Maybe this should be a separate question, but both questions arose at the same time:
Is there any way of changing the contents of a movie icon inside the "Connections" area?
I've tried to drag-drop new information over an icon already containing information and I can't just replace old data with new data that way, but I can't find a way to do it otherwise, within "Connections".
DEL removes the whole movie icon, and right-clicking the mouse doesn't bring up a menu that offers any options about that.

Not sure if I really understand what you are loking to do; you can rename movies either from the left hand Project layout area (left click) or from the Connections window (right click). As to what DVD lab regards as the 'real' second (or whatever) movie, then that's established by whatever connections/menu screen setup you use. The Movie 1, 2 etc names given by DVD Lab are really irrelevent.

In one case I deleted the second movie icon, so "2" was gone, and creating a new movie icon created "5", and I couldn't rename "5" as "2": when the project was created, what I'd wanted as the second movie ran as number five. I couldn't figure any way of reassigning the actual values of the icons.
Which meant that the contents of 3 and 4 had to be emptied, I had to put the data meant for "2" into "3" now because I didn't have a "Movie 2" anymore, and I couldn't make a "Movie 2" either. So "Movie 3" now had to act as "Movie 2".
Which seemed really clumsy and unlikely, considering the power and complexity of DVD-Lab. But no matter what I try, I can't find any way to replace a deleted movie icon.
And I can't find any simple way of transferring contents from one to another either.

Just relink your links from menus. Doesn't matter what dvdlab calls movie 2 or movie 5 or whatever.
Just link properly, and it will work.
Open your menu, right click on the link you want to reassign, and reassign it to whatever movie/menu you want.Cheers, Jim
